Subject: Handover — Skylark field-survey offline mode

Team,

Short version for plugin authors: offline mode queues writes in a local ledger and syncs when connectivity returns. Conflicts resolve last-write-wins per field, not per record. Your plugins must tolerate replayed events; idempotency keys are mandatory from v3. Sync cursor state and the replay log live in the coordination database, reachable with the connection string below.

primary connection of yagep-kahip = redis://giliel_svc:zYiKsLL2PLpfPL@db-348f.xolmarsys.corp:5432/fenwyn

## Runbook: Autocomplete Index Remediation — Findlet Search

When the Findlet autocomplete index falls behind, the remediation release rebuilds the prefix trie from the nightly snapshot and redeploys the query nodes in two waves. All remediation artifacts are built in the locked pipeline and signed before distribution; reviewers should confirm the build provenance record matches the tag. Wave two does not start until wave one passes the latency canary. Artifact verification uses the signing key below.

signing key of bagap-yawep = bky13_TbfT6ZMUoGJo2

Ticket: PAY-2241 — Integration tests failing on expired credentials

The Ledgerline payments integration suite has been flaky since Tuesday because the sandbox credentials expired. Roughly a third of runs fail at the authorization step. This blocks the Thursday release cut unless rotated today. A fresh key has been issued for the sandbox gateway and is included below.

gateway credential: kto3_qfe

Subject: TideScope widget cut-over complete

Hi — quick summary before you review the PR. We cut TideScope's tide-table widget over to the new harmonic prediction backend on Tuesday. Old polling path is removed; the widget now subscribes to the push feed and falls back to cached tables if the feed stalls. Rendering code is untouched, so visual diffs should be empty. Error rates held flat through the switch. For reference while reviewing, here is the production configuration the widget now runs with.

deployment values, yagaf-yahig:
[ralion]
team = silok
access_code = ac_e16f3a
owner = aldvan.ulaion
host = ralion.qorvelgrid.corp
port = 9200
peer = ulamir.ferracorp.test
salt = 258b1b36
pin = 3673